Adidas secures double US university deal

Sportswear company Adidas has struck a new long-term partnership with the University of Miami and extended an existing deal with Florida International University.

The Miami deal will run for 12 years, from 2015-16 until 2026-27.

Under the agreement, which will come into effect from September, Adidas will replace rival Nike as the official athletic, footwear, apparel and accessory brand of the university’s Hurricanes sports teams. This arrangement will include investment, product and uniform development for all 18 intercollegiate Hurricane athletic programmes.

Meanwhile, the renewed deal with Florida International University will run for two years, from 2015-16 until 2016-17, with the option of two additional one-year extensions.

The agreement, which will extend a partnership that began in 2005, will allow Adidas to continue to provide kit to the university’s Panthers sports teams. According to the university’s Student Media website, the deal is worth a total of about $2.6m (€2.1m)
